Ep 154: How Many Greens Are There?
from PolitiCoast: The BC Politics Podcast
Stewart Prest joins Scott to break down the BC Utility Commission’s inquiry report on gas prices and kerfuffle between the NDP and the Green Party over 14-ish former New Brunswick NDP candidates.
